Transforming your workspace from chaos to creativity is more than just aesthetic; it's a key to unlocking productivity. Start by decluttering your desk, removing unnecessary items that distract you. Create designated spaces for supplies and tools, utilizing organizers or boxes to streamline your environment. Once you've cleared the clutter, consider incorporating effective design elements that inspire. For instance, adding plants can enhance mood and air quality, while utilizing bright colors or artwork can stimulate creativity.
Next, focus on creating a functional layout that promotes efficiency. Think about the flow of your work; arrange your desk so that everything you need is within arm's reach. Implement ergonomic furniture to ensure comfort during long hours. Additionally, using flexible lighting options, such as adjustable desk lamps or natural light, can dramatically influence your working experience. By thoughtfully redesigning your workspace, you can transition from disarray to a space that fosters inspiration and enhances productivity.

The psychological impact of a workspace is profound, shaping not just productivity but also the level of creativity that individuals exhibit. Studies indicate that an environment infused with natural light, vibrant colors, and personalized décor can dramatically increase a person's motivational levels. For instance, a workspace that incorporates elements of biophilic design, such as indoor plants or natural materials, fosters a sense of connection with nature, which has been shown to enhance cognitive function and creative problem-solving.
Moreover, the organization and layout of a workspace play crucial roles in stimulating creativity. Open-plan offices or collaborative spaces encourage teamwork and the exchange of ideas, while private areas provide solitude for deep thinking. According to psychological studies, the freedom to choose one's workspace configuration can lead to greater satisfaction and a sense of ownership, which in turn fuels creative output. Therefore, understanding the intricate relationship between environment and mental processes is essential for businesses aiming to unleash the full creative potential of their teams.
